WARNING!
READ ALL INSTRUCTIONS IN THIS GUIDE BEFORE ASSEMBLING OR
USING YOUR HARD FLOOR WET/DRY VACUUM CLEANER. To reduce the
risk of re, electrical shock, injury to persons or damage when using your
hard oor wet/dry vacuum cleaner, follow all safety precautions listed
below.
IMPORTANT S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S
Use your hard oor wet/
dry vacuum cleaner only as
described in this Use & Care
Guide.
Use on indoor hard oors only.
Do not allow it to be used as a
toy. Close attention is necessary
when used by or near children,
pets or plants.
Use only manufacturer’s
recommended attachments.
Do not put any object into
openings. Do not use with
any opening blocked; keep
openings free of dust, lint, hair,
and anything that may reduce
air ow.
Keep hair, loose clothing,
ngers, and parts of body away
from openings and moving
parts.
Use extra care when cleaning on
stairs.
Do not use to pick up ammable
or combustible materials (lighter
uid, gasoline, kerosene, etc.) or
use in areas where they may be
present.
Do not use the appliance in
an enclosed space lled with
vapors given off by oil-based
paint, paint thinner, some moth-
proong substances, ammable
dust, or other explosive or toxic
vapors.
Do not pick up toxic material
(chlorine bleach, ammonia,
drain cleaner, etc.).
Do not pick up anything that
is burning or smoking, such
as cigarettes, matches, or hot
ashes.
Do not pick up hard or sharp
objects such as glass, nails,
screws, coins, etc.
Do not carry the appliance while
in use.
Do not immerse. Use only on
surfaces moistened by the
cleaning process.
Packing materials can be
dangerous.
Do not use without lters or
tanks in place.
Always connect to a proper
electrical socket.
Do not charge the appliance
outdoors.
Do not charge with a damaged
cord or plug.
Do not pull or carry the charging
adapter by cord, use the cord
as a handle, close a door on the
cord, or pull the cord around
sharp edges or corners. Keep
cord away from heated surfaces.
Do not unplug by pulling on
the charging adapter cord. To
unplug, grasp the charging
plug, not the cord.
